From 60afdd43a9ac0fbf947bd492f5219c90d03d23ec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Jose Abreu <Jose.Abreu@synopsys.com>
Date: Wed, 6 Nov 2019 16:03:05 +0100
Subject: [PATCH 11/13] net: stmmac: Fix the TX IOC in xmit path
Git-commit: 7df4a3a76d34fe1f550e82c6ef368c7c40f0aaa4
Patch-mainline: v5.4-rc7
References: git-fixes

IOC bit must be only set in the last descriptor. Move the logic up a
little bit to make sure it's set in the correct descriptor.

Signed-off-by: Jose Abreu <Jose.Abreu@synopsys.com>
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@davemloft.net>
Signed-off-by: Denis Kirjanov <denis.kirjanov@suse.com>
